Sealing element for sealing a gap between concrete pavements/structures
Abstract
A sealing element (100) for sealing a gap (205) between concrete pavements (S1, S2) is disclosed. The sealing element (100) comprises a housing (105) provided in a solid structure. The sealing element (100) comprises a plurality of fins (110) coupled to the housing (105) at outer surface. The housing (105) is compressed and placed between concrete pavements (S1, S2) having a gap (205) may be in between a range of 1 mm to 5 mm. The housing (105) expands outward and the housing (105) is held against walls (202, 204) of the concrete pavements (S1, S2). The plurality of fins grips are held against walls (202, 204) of the concrete pavements (S1, S2).

1 . A sealing element ( 100 ) for sealing a gap ( 205 ) between concrete pavements (Si, S 2 ), comprising:
a housing ( 105 ) provided in a solid structure; and a plurality of fins ( 110 ) coupled to the housing ( 105 ) at outer surface, wherein the housing ( 105 ) is compressed and placed between concrete pavements (S 1 , S 2 ) having a gap ( 205 ) may be in between a range of 1 mm to 5 mm, wherein the housing ( 105 ) expands outward and the housing ( 105 ) is held against walls ( 202 , 204 ) of the concrete pavements (S 1 , S 2 ), and wherein the plurality of fins grips are held against walls ( 202 , 204 ) of the concrete pavements (S 1 , S 2 ).
2 . The sealing element ( 100 ) as claimed in claim 1 , wherein the housing ( 105 ) is a continuous strip or jointed strip
3 . The sealing element ( 100 ) as claimed in claim 1 , wherein the housing ( 105 ) is made using one of:
rubber, plastic, ethylene vinyl acetate, and combination thereof.
4 . The sealing element ( 100 ) as claimed in claim 1 , wherein the plurality of fins ( 110 ) are coupled to the housing ( 105 ) symmetrically or asymmetrically.
5 . The sealing element ( 100 ) as claimed in claim 1 , wherein the plurality of fins ( 110 ) are coupled at perpendicular or at an acute angle at length of the housing ( 105 ).
6 . The sealing element ( 100 ) as claimed in claim 5 , wherein the plurality of fins ( 110 ) are spaced at equal distance or at variable distance.
7 . The sealing element ( 100 ) as claimed in claim 1 , wherein width of the sealing element ( 100 ) is reduced to 1:10 when the housing ( 105 ) is compressed.
8 . The sealing element ( 100 ) as claimed in claim 1 , wherein width of the housing ( 105 ) is less, equal or more than the length of the sealing element ( 100 ) prior to compression.
9 . The sealing element ( 100 ) as claimed in claim 1 , wherein the sealing element ( 100 ) comprises an adhesive provided at substrate of the housing ( 105 ) to hold and to strengthen the sealing element ( 100 ) against the walls ( 202 , 204 ) of the concrete pavements (S 1 , S 2 ).
